Two highway cops in hospital after trucker falls asleep on the motorway

 

11pm.jpg

 

Two highway policemen were injured after an 18 wheel truck plowed into a patrol car on the motorway inbound to Bangkok yesterday.

 

The police had pulled over a ten wheel truck for illegally passing in an outer lane. 

 

Senior sergeant majors Kraiyuth who was driving and Thanaphon on radio duties were taken to hospital.

 

Witthawat, 29, said he had made a delivery in Rayong and was on his way back to the company in Saraburi.

 

He said he felt sleepy and tried to fight it until the parking area at the weigh station in Muang Chonburi. There was no where before then to stop safely, he said.

 

He saw that the police had pulled over a truck onto the hard shoulder ahead but then he had a microsleep and hit the patrol car and the other truck. 

 

He said it was lucky no one was killed and apologized.

 

Rattana, 28, the driver of the ten wheeler said he was pulled over after overtaking illegally. 

 

The accident happened at KM marker 88 in the SiRacha area of Chonburi.
